The present invention provides a kind of dedicated early-strength admixture of prefabricated components concrete, the raw material including following weight percent:
Polycarboxylic acids water reducing type mother liquor 15-25%;
Polycarboxylic acids collapse protection type mother liquor 6-15%;
Accelerating component 6-12%;
Anti- mud component 3-8%;
Anti-educing component 1-3%;
Surplus is water.
Preferably, a kind of dedicated early-strength admixture of prefabricated components concrete, the original including following weight percent
Material:
Polycarboxylic acids water reducing type mother liquor 16-22%;
Polycarboxylic acids collapse protection type mother liquor 8-12%;
Accelerating component 8-10%;
Anti- mud component 3-5%;
Anti-educing component 1%;
Surplus is water.
Preferably, the polycarboxylic acids water reducing type mother liquor is one in acrylic compounds or methacrylic polycarboxylic acids mother liquor
Kind.
Preferably, the polycarboxylic acids collapse protection type mother liquor is isoamyl alcohol polyoxyethylene ether class or methacrylic polyoxyethylene
One of ethers polycarboxylic acids mother liquor.
Preferably, the accelerating component is pressed the ratio of 3:4:2:1 by aluminum sulfate, sodium acetate, calcium nitrite and triisopropanolamine
Example is combined.
Preferably, the anti-mud component is combined by odium stearate and ethylene glycol in the ratio of 6:4 or 7:3.
Preferably, the anti-educing component is sorbierite.
Preferably, the preparation method of the dedicated early-strength admixture of prefabricated components concrete, comprising the following steps:
Step 1: weighing or preparing each component according to the proportion;
Step 2: agitator tank is added in polycarboxylic acids water reducing type mother liquor and polycarboxylic acids collapse protection type mother liquor, 90s or more is added water and stirred, is made
It is sufficiently mixed;
Step 3: accelerating component is added in mixed liquor made from step 2,120s or more is stirred, dissolves it sufficiently;
Step 4: anti-mud component is added in mixed liquor made from step 3,60s or more is stirred, dissolves it sufficiently;
Step 5: anti-educing component is added in mixed liquor made from step 4,30s or more is stirred, mixes them thoroughly, obtains
The dedicated early-strength admixture of prefabricated components concrete.
The work of several main raw material(s)s is now used as following elaboration by technical solution of the present invention for ease of understanding:
1. the present invention is using polycarboxylic acids water reducing type mother liquor as diminishing component.The polycarboxylic acids mother liquor synthesized with acrylic or methacrylic acid
Have the effect of water-reducing rate superelevation, guarantees the high water reducing rate for compounding additive with this;
2. the present invention is to protect component of collapsing with polycarboxylic acids collapse protection type mother liquor.With isoamyl alcohol polyoxyethylene ether or methacrylic polyoxy
The polycarboxylic acids mother liquor of vinethene synthesis has the effect of high-thin arch dam, guarantees the high-thin arch dam ability for compounding additive with this;
3. the present invention is using aluminum sulfate, sodium acetate, calcium nitrite and triisopropanolamine as accelerating component.Aluminum sulfate is strong electrolyte,
The ionic strength in cement slurry can be improved.In the hydration process of cement, aluminum sulfate is dissolved in the hydrogen that water and hydrated cementitious generate
Calcium oxide reaction generates calcium sulfate and sodium hydroxide;Sodium acetate can reduce the concentration of cement hydrolysate in water, to promote
Into the raising of the cement components solution rate such as tricalcium silicate and tricalcium aluminate, accelerate the hydrated products such as entringite, C-S-H gel
It generates, accelerates the condensation and hardening of cement;Calcium nitrite can promote hydrated calcium silicate (C-S-H) to generate, accelerate the water of cement
Change, improves the pore structure of hydrated product, concrete structure is closely knit;The good dispersion of triisopropanolamine, surface-active are superior, can add
The activity of aquation generation colloid by force plays the role of aggravation absorption, soaks and disperse particle, quickening concrete strength is developed,
It is beneficial to improve intensity, the density and impermeability of concrete additionally can be improved;
4. the present invention is with odium stearate and ethylene glycol for anti-mud component.Odium stearate can be preferentially adsorbed on clay surface, inhibit
Clay interlayer structure water swelling reduces concrete viscosity, to have the function that anti-mud;The addition of ethylene glycol can enhance tristearin
The peptizaiton of sour sodium, two kinds of materials show excellent synergistic effect, make agent on crack resistance of concrete mud capability improving;
5. the present invention is using sorbierite as anti-educing component.Sorbierite can reduce polycarboxylate water-reducer to the sensibility of water consumption,
There is certain contraction to concrete simultaneously, to achieve the purpose that anti-isolation.
Compared with prior art, the invention has the benefit that
Under 1.25 DEG C of curing conditions, C30 concrete 3d intensity is obviously improved, and 1d intensity can reach 15MPa, and 3d intensity can reach
25MPa accelerates prefabricated components demoulding time;
2. concrete goes out slump free of losses in machine 30min, meet prefabricated components production needs;
Phenomena such as 3. concrete workability is good, viscosity is low, no isolation bleeding;
It is not in strength retraction phenomenon 4. concrete long-age gain in strength is stablized.
